PHP Класс eZ\Bundle\EzPublishRestBundle\Tests\Functional\SessionTest

Наследование: extends TestCase
Показать файл Открыть проект

Открытые методы

Метод Описание
setUp ( )
testCreateSession ( ) : stdClass
testCreateSessionBadCredentials ( )
testDeleteSession ( )
testDeleteSessionExpired ( $session )
testDeleteSessionMissingCsrfToken ( ) CSRF needs to be tested as session handling bypasses the CsrfListener.
testLoginWithExistingFrontendSession ( )
testRefreshSession ( stdClass $session )
testRefreshSessionExpired ( )
testRefreshSessionMissingCsrfToken ( )

Защищенные методы

Метод Описание
createDeleteRequest ( $session ) : Buzz\Message\Request
createRefreshRequest ( stdClass $session ) : Buzz\Message\Request

Приватные методы

Метод Описание
assertHttpResponseDeletesSessionCookie ( $session, Buzz\Message\Response $response )
removeCsrfHeader ( Buzz\Message\Request $request ) Removes the CSRF token header from a $request.

Описание методов

createDeleteRequest() защищенный Метод

protected createDeleteRequest ( $session ) : Buzz\Message\Request
$session
Результат Buzz\Message\Request

createRefreshRequest() защищенный Метод

protected createRefreshRequest ( stdClass $session ) : Buzz\Message\Request
$session stdClass
Результат Buzz\Message\Request

setUp() публичный Метод

public setUp ( )

testCreateSession() публичный Метод

public testCreateSession ( ) : stdClass
Результат stdClass The login request's response

testCreateSessionBadCredentials() публичный Метод

testDeleteSession() публичный Метод

public testDeleteSession ( )

testDeleteSessionExpired() публичный Метод

public testDeleteSessionExpired ( $session )

testDeleteSessionMissingCsrfToken() публичный Метод

CSRF needs to be tested as session handling bypasses the CsrfListener.

testLoginWithExistingFrontendSession() публичный Метод

testRefreshSession() публичный Метод

public testRefreshSession ( stdClass $session )
$session stdClass

testRefreshSessionExpired() публичный Метод

testRefreshSessionMissingCsrfToken() публичный Метод